Shadow AI and Approved Tools

Why the free new AI tool is not free, and how to champion a tool the right way.

What to remember

  • Free AI tools are paid with your data: the fine print often lets your content train models and reach partners you never met, and your checkbox says yes for the whole company.
  • Small tools mean small security: a breach at a five-person vendor is your pasted data in a public dump, and your company cannot warn you about a tool it never knew existed.
  • A personal email does not hide a tool on a work laptop; it makes the invisibility false, and most companies can see which AI tools run on their network as normal hygiene.
  • Requesting a tool takes three lines (the tool, what you would use it for, what data would go in), and you get a yes or a safer alternative; the same three lines cover AI features that switch themselves on inside tools you already use.
  • Finding great tools is a valued instinct: be the scout who walks them through the front door.
